This center treats mental health conditions and co-occurring substance use. You receive collaborative, individualized treatment that addresses both issues for whole-person healing.

In the heart of Chattanooga, Erlanger Behavioral Health offers a lifeline: mental health and addiction treatment. Their 144-bed center offers a safe, healing space for individuals of all ages—from adolescents to seniors—navigating the challenges of psychiatric disorders, substance use or both. Whether someone is in crisis and needs inpatient stabilization or is ready for a structured outpatient program, they meet people where they are. Erlanger takes a collaborative approach to treatment, where care is comprehensive and compassionate. Every client’s plan is shaped by a team of medical and behavioral doctors who understand that lasting recovery comes from treating the whole person, not just the diagnosis. Their programs are structured but flexible, combining psychiatric and medical support, all delivered in a setting to make clients feel safe and heard. In the foothills of Chattanooga, Erlanger Behavioral Health is designed to be a refuge from the chaos and pain that often accompany behavioral health concerns. With peaceful outdoor spaces and welcoming communal areas, every detail is crafted to support comfort and healing. Whether taking a quiet moment in nature or sharing a meal with peers, clients can begin to exhale for the first time in a long time. Erlanger Behavioral Health understands that transitioning back to everyday life can be one of the most vulnerable points in a client’s journey. That’s why their aftercare planning begins the moment they arrive. They create individualized roadmaps for ongoing support, whether that means outpatient care, support groups, medication management, or community resources.
